HVAC (Heating Ventilation and Air Conditioning) – Basic Facts

Heating, Ventilation, and Air Conditioning (HVAC) are a broad term that is used in the field of home and building heating and air conditioning. It is a group of processes that includes several different types of systems that can be used for heating and cooling indoor spaces, such as homes, offices, hotels, and health care facilities. HVAC can refer to any one or more of these processes, but the majority of homeowners understand what it means. HVAC systems are used in almost every type of building, including privately owned residential homes, office buildings, businesses, and public facilities.
